Measurements CVMMXN

Mode of operation
The measurement function must be connected to three-phase current and three-
phase voltage input in the configuration tool (group signals), but it is capable to
measure and calculate above mentioned quantities in nine different ways depending
on the available VT inputs connected to the IED. The end user can freely select by
a parameter setting, which one of the nine available measuring modes shall be used
within the function. Available options are summarized in the following table:
